Straight in front of the passenger. You'll have to take either the dash insert or top piece off to get at it.

Pull the pipe off the windscreen jet and pull it all out. That way you can check if there is a one way valve before messing with the pump. The pipe is cheap to replace.
 
My return valve can be viewed if I take off the dash top. Why dont you pull the hose off the pump and check it again to see if water is coming out. Pumps are not expensive either.
